GUIDE: Making Pure White Cloth

Obtaining the Materials

<u>Initial Items Required</u>
1x Bag of Sending

Step 1:

Attend the tavern in Minoc and speak to "Ben the Apprentice Necromancer":



To confirm his location:



Co-Ordinates: 107o 39'N, 80o 22'E

Step 2:

Upon speaking with him, you will receive a quest:



Accept the quest and you'll receive a "Spirit Bottle", as shown:



The quest requires you to take this bottle to the "Ghost of Frederic Smithson".

Step 3:

Go to the ghost who is located between the first and second levels of Covetous dungeon:



To confirm the location:



Co-Ordinates: 64o 41'N, 77o 3'E

Step 4:

Talk to the ghost. Doing so will prompt the following dialogue:



The ghost will then offer you the secondary part of the quest:



Accepting the quest will drop this item into your backpack:



Step 5:

Use a Bag of Sending on the Dread Spider Silk:



This will send that quest item directly to your bank.

Step 6:

After sending it, resign from the quest. To do so, open your Paperdoll and click the "Quests" button:



This will bring up a list of all the quests you're currently on. Click the arrow next to the "Save his Dad" quest:



Then press the "Resign" button:



The "Dread Spider Silk" will remain in your bank box after resigning. You will require 1 Dread Spider Silk for every bolt of the pure white cloth you wish to make, and one you send will be unusable. For example, you need at least 2 silk to create 1 bolt of the cloth, 3 silk to create 2 bolts, 4 silk to create 3 bolts, etc.

To create more of it, simply follow steps 4 through 6 repeatedly until you are happy with the amount of silk you have. Contrary to what I see many people doing, you do not have to continually start the initial quest that Ben the Apprentice Necromancer offers you; you can simply talk to the ghost again after resigning for more wool.

Creating the Cloth

<u>Initial Items Required</u>
Dread Spider Silk (shown above)
Access to a Spinning Wheel
Access to a Loom
Yarn (4 yarn per every 1 bolt you wish to make)

Step 1:

Access your bank box. You should see the silk you sent earlier:



Drag all except 1 silk from your bankbox to your main backpack:



Note: It is critical that you follow this step carefully. Dragging the entire stack will mean you will be unable to 'use' the silk; you must split it and leave 1 behind which can either be discarded, kept as a base for more silk that you'll send in future or used to finish the quest.

Step 2:

Now that the silk is in your backpack, head to a spinning wheel. There are many all over Britannia in tailor shops. In my example I used the Luna Tailor shop.

Double click the pile of silk and spin it on the spinning wheel:



After a few seconds, you will receive 3 balls of pure white yarn in your backpack per 1 ball of silk you spin as shown below. Repeat as necessary until you've span all of your silks.



Step 3:

Take the regular balls of yarn you should have started with (can be purchased from tailor NPCs, or you can sheer sheep to obtain sheep wool, which can be spun on the spinning wheel to obtain normal yarn similar to the method of spinning the silks) and your pure white yarn to a loom. Again, there's often looms in tailor shops; there's one in the Luna tailor shop also, which is where I'm staying for the example.

Double click the regular yarn, then 'use' it with the loom:



Do this 4 times until you receive the "This bolt is almost finished..." message from the loom like so:



To finish the bolt of cloth, double click one of the pure white yarn balls you created and use it with the loom:



This will create a pure white cloth bolt in your backpack:



This can then be cut with scissors like any bolt to create pure white cloth for use in tailoring, or whatever:
